I was sitting in front of a friend when one time I saw her make a heart out of the wrapping paper gum. She gave that heart to me. So, I would always have it in my backpack because I thought it was a nice gesture. One day she noticed I had kept it. Since that day, whenever she had gum, she would always make a heart for me. I believe she felt happy and appreciated that I kept something she thought was simple.
Giving can come in many forms, whether it can change a person’s life or a simple piece of paper heart. But what is more important is the way both the giver and the receiver feel. Giving fosters happiness; it draws us closer to other people and increases a positive view of life and warmth.
My way of giving back; is by providing my help to others in gratitude for what they have given me. It does not matter what I receive. As long as their intention was good, I will always be thankful and try to repair it with kindness and empathy.

This may sound peculiar, but I cannot help but love the smell of unique things. The aroma of Home Depot, for example, is extraordinary. It brings me a sense of joy and relaxation. Or like a bizarre non-food craving that I want to eat every time I go there. Therefore, I enjoy a good sniff of Home Depot.
I still do not know the reason behind this obsession I have with home depot’s particular smell. Is it the smell of fresh lumber, the different chemicals, or the opposite end of the store where the garden is? Who knows; it might be a combination of everything they have. But one thing for sure I can tell apart from and love is the smell of fresh lumber. Fresh cut wood has a strong scent that I can smell a mile away before entering the store. Luckily, I can appreciate the smell frequently; because my dad likes to go to Home Depot a lot.
